Türk Prysmian Kablo, located in Mudanya district of Bursa, continued to grow in both domestic and international markets according to its financial results for 2020.
BURSA (İGFA) – Explaining, Türk Prysmian Kablo factory increased its turnover by 23 percent compared to 2019, to 1 billion 802 million 184 thousand 466 TL. The net profit of the company, which increased the share of exports in turnover to 37 percent compared to 2019, was announced as 42 million 418 thousand 644 TL with an increase of 17.9 percent compared to the previous year.
R&D EXPENDITURES RISE ALSO
In its factory in Mudanya, the first T.C. Türk Prysmian Kablo, which has an R&D Center approved by the Ministry of Science, Industry and Technology, has announced that its R&D expenditures increased by 14.4 percent in 2020, reaching 4 million 651 thousand 103 TL.
